Lille OSC have completed the signing of Portugal International, Jose Fonte on a free transfer.
Fonte earlier this week terminated his contract with Dalian Yifang and signed a two-year contract with the Ligue 1 outfit.
Despite making just nine competitive appearances for the club, he featured in all four games for Portugal at the just concluded World Cup in Russia.
The Portugal International has also featured for Crystal Palace, West Ham and Southampton in England, playing with the Saints in League One, through Sky Bet Championship before gaining promotion to the Premier League.
The Portugal International moved to West Ham in January 2017 before switching to China in about 13 months.
The 34-year old joining Lille now has been saddled with leadership responsibility alongside Loic Remy for a side that barely escaped relegation last season.
